Enemy activity / threat assessment
- Russian strikes continue to compress Ukrainian rear nodes and hit civilian transport. The new Poltava Raion strike on an industrial enterprise and energy infrastructure, the Nikopolshchyna passenger-bus attack killing five, and the Kyiv/Kyiv Oblast strike effects carried forward form a consistent pattern: energy, industrial and civil-transport targets on the central, southern and capital rear axes. MEDIUM for the pattern of reported effects; LOW for the Russian MoD's specific target characterisations.
- Westward jet-UAV transit continues on the Kyiv axis. Kaharlyk→Vasylkiv and Slavutych→Kyiv Oblast tracks extend the observed westward transit belt onto the capital approach, matching last cycle's Chernihiv and Zhytomyr corridors. Assessed as continued use of established corridors rather than a new capability. MEDIUM.
- Polish airspace caution as a side effect. Lublin and Podkarpackie air-alert declarations and Rzeszów/Lublin airport suspensions are described as a consequence of the strikes on western Ukraine — a reminder that Russian strike packages continue to route near NATO airspace on the western axis (Оперативний ЗСУ, 06:20 UTC; MEDIUM).
- Multi-domain information effort is intensifying. This cycle contains a coordinated seam of partisan and pro-Russian content: Shtirlitz "Cargo 200" composite claiming six Russian/police officer deaths; Архангел Спецназа claim of a Chechen militant's stabbing death in Lviv; Patrushev's threat to Poland amplified via a Finnish aggregator; the "Дневник Десантника" gamified donation post. All are marked LOW and should not be aggregated into battlefield assessments. LOW–MEDIUM as an indicator of continued enemy and adversary information activity.
- Assessed likely Russian COA (next 6–12h): Continuation of the ongoing UAV attack and possible follow-on wave; further jet-UAV transits into the Kyiv, Chernihiv, Cherkasy, Volyn and Mykolaiv corridors; continued KAB/UMPK employment against Kharkiv, Sumy, Dnipropetrovsk, Donetsk and Zaporizhzhia Oblasts; sustained assault pressure on the Pokrovsk, Kostiantynivka, South Slobozhansky and Huliaipole axes; continued strikes on rail, road-transport and port nodes in the Kyiv, Odesa and southern rear; continued counter-battery and counter-UAS activity in Zaporizhzhia and Donbas. MEDIUM for pattern; LOW for verified effects.
- Assessed most dangerous Russian COA: A converging UAV or KAB package against an energy, rail, port or civil-transport node — most plausibly on the Nikopol–Dnipropetrovsk axis in light of the bus strike, on the Kyiv–Mykolaiv rail corridor, or at Chornomorsk; a concentrated glide-bomb package against a populated Kharkiv, Kostiantynivka, Sloviansk, Pokrovsk or Sumy-front settlement; and continued attritional pressure on the Pokrovsk axis where assault density is highest. LOW confidence pending corroboration.

Outlook (next 6–12h)
- Weather, as of 06:15 UTC (Open-Meteo, UTC; HIGH for numeric values): Kharkiv/Vovchansk 13.0 °C, overcast, wind 2.5 m/s, cloud 100 %, 0.0 mm; Luhansk/Svatove 13.7 °C, overcast, wind 2.2 m/s, cloud 100 %, 0.0 mm; Donetsk/Pokrovsk 12.8 °C, overcast, wind 2.8 m/s, cloud 100 %, 0.0 mm; Zaporizhzhia/Orikhiv 15.1 °C, overcast, wind 3.4 m/s, cloud 89 %, 0.0 mm; Kherson 15.8 °C, overcast, wind 1.6 m/s, cloud 71 %, 0.0 mm. Daily forecast for 16 September: Vovchansk 9.4/17.4 °C, light rain, precipPmax 23 %, precipSum 0.9 mm, windMax 3.0 m/s; Svatove 12.7/16.1 °C, light rain, precipSum 0.2 mm, windMax 3.3 m/s; Pokrovsk 11.6/16.0 °C, overcast, 0.0 mm, windMax 3.1 m/s; Orikhiv 13.0/20.5 °C, overcast, 0.0 mm, windMax 4.7 m/s; Kherson 12.6/22.3 °C, overcast, 0.0 mm, windMax 2.0 m/s. Assessed: near-total cloud at Vovchansk, Svatove and Pokrovsk continues to limit optical reconnaissance and can degrade laser designation and some guided-bomb accuracy; the light rain at Vovchansk and Svatove may locally disrupt FPV/UAV employment; the elevated Orikhiv windMax (4.7 m/s) may marginally affect small-UAV employment on the Zaporizhzhia axis; Kherson remains overcast with light wind — permissive for the southern maritime launch belt.
